  • The San Diego Asian Film Festival (SDAFF) is San Diego’s premier film showcase of Asian American and international cinema. Founded in 2000, the festival has grown to become the largest exhibition of Asian cinema in the western United States, and has showcased everything from future classics like Bong Joon-ho’s "Memories of Murder" (US Premiere) to luminary independent work like Patrick Wang’s award-winning "In the Family" (North American Premiere). Each year, the festival brings West Coast, North American, and World premieres of films from around the world to San Diego and gives audiences unique opportunities to discover international cinema. This year, the 26th edition of SDAFF will showcase 150+ films from 30+ countries, in 30+ languages from November 6 – 15, 2025. Pacific Arts Movement on Facebook / Instagram
  • Come find out about the uniqueness and wonder of ferns and lycophytes. CNPS, San Diego Chapter presents a talk by Jon P. Rebman about local Ferns and Lycophytes. Jon P. Rebman, Ph.D. and Annette Winner are the authors of a new filed guide titled “Ferns and Lycophytes of San Diego County”. This field guide has descriptions, keys for identification, local natural history information, and a color plate for each species that shows all of the key characters important for getting to know these species. This publication is part of the San Diego Natural History Museum’s journal series, the Proceedings of the San Diego Society of Natural History. It will be available for purchase at the meeting, and may be signed by Dr. Rebman.   • All puns are intended! Competitive punning is a growing, worldwide pasttime, and Pundemonium! is based on the format used by pun contests in other cities, including the O. Henry Pun-Off in Austin, TX, Punderdome in New York, Pun DMV in Washington, D.C, It's Always Punny in Philadelphia, UK Pun-Off in London, and more. Watch, laugh, groan, or join punsters competing to see who is the wizard of wordplay, the dean of dad jokes, the punniest of them all. Competitive punning is a *thing* nationwide, and Pundemonium! is San Diego's home for the war of wordplay. Pundemonium! is a two-part event based on the format used by pun contests in cities such as New York, Philadelphia, Washington, D.C., Austin, TX, San Francisco, and more. See: https://www.wired.com/2016/09/pun-competitions/ In Part 1, Battle of the PUNdits, participants who have signed up in advance will deliver two-minute pun-filled speeches, and the audience will determine the winner. Part 2, the PUNger Games, is a head-to-head pun-off tournament-style. Think of it as an on-the-spot rap battle with puns. You do not have to participate!
